    Cellulose fast thinners is very good at removing residue from carburettor Jett's. Just find the jets and soak them in thinners and maybe get single strand of stiff brush hair in the jet. Sometimes just submerge very small carbs in thinners overnight. Also blast out with an airosol of carb cleaner.

    A can of carburetor cleaner is really all you need you don't need an ultrasonic cleaner dude I don't have an ultrasonic cleaner and I service my own weed eater chainsaw any of my 2-stroke Motors carburetors myself most four strokes and when applicable older cars and I've never used an ultrasonic cleaner all I've ever had was a can of carburetor cleaner and the spray stick that usually comes with cans and I completely disassemble it pull the needle Jets and take the stick and spray a good couple sprays through each hole in the carburetor and let it dry and then just reassemble it but I never spray the diaphragms or gaskets because carburetor cleaner will destroy them but that stuff dries up pretty fast and then I just put the diaphragms back in whenever it's the carb parts are dry and I've only bought rebuild kits whenever the diaphragms getting worn out or the needle jet Springs news there rigidness good video though
